The heat deflection temperature or heat distortion temperature (HDT, HDTUL, or DTUL) is the temperature at which a polymer or plastic sample deforms under a specified load. [1] This property of a given plastic material is applied in many aspects of product design, engineering and manufacture of products using thermoplastic components.

Acrylic elastomer is a general term for a type of synthetic rubber whose primary component is acrylic acid alkyl ester (ethyl or butyl ester). [3] Acrylic elastomer possesses characteristics of heat and oil resistance, with the ability to withstand temperatures of 170–180 °C. ASA can be made by either a reaction process of all three monomers (styrene, acrylonitrile, acrylic ester) or a graft process, although the graft process is the typical method. A grafted acrylic ester elastomer is introduced during the copolymerization of styrene and acrylonitrile. The elastomer is introduced as a powder. [11]
